    Hi Everyone! It's so nice to see that this thread is still going. I visited the CNE in Toronto today and saw a booth that was selling Target merchandise. Some of the items I clearly recall seeing are: Merona and Mossimo shoes for $9.99, Method 50 load fabric softener for $3.99, belts for $5.00, and Room Essentials drawer dividers for 99 cents. They also had a wide selection of school supplies and school bags. Almost all of the items at the booth were Target brands, or had Target clearance stickers. If you are missing Target as much as I am, it could be worth your while to hunt through the items. The booth is called "Entertainment Liquidators of Canada" and is located in the Enercare Centre with the other outlet shops. I wish I could have snapped some photos, but it was quite busy, and difficult for me to manoeuvre through the crowd with the stroller.
